While the term "portal" itself is not new, it is also not clearly defined within the marketplace. In general, portals provide a personalized single point of access to applications, content, processes and services and are designed to enhance operational efficiencies and collaboration through a secure Web interface.
Adding to their complexity is the fact that nearly every e-business or Web based project needs a secure infrastructure for hosting Web-based Applications. There are several common challenges that organizations face when implementing these applications. First, the site needs to provide a means of determining who is accessing the site (authentication). Second, the site needs the capability to permit or deny access to resources based on the policies and users/groups that access the resources (authorization). Third, users desire to only log on once for access to applications to which they have been granted access (single sign-on).
Secure portals address the issues of authentication, authorization and single sign-on, which are needed when the information is of a sensitive nature.
